Software types of defects in solid

Top10 injection molding defects and how to fix them. It is shown that there are always defects in solids, i. So, how do you decide on the extent of defects and the type of defects that you can golive with. All solids contain defects, where the ideal lattice as described in terms of an infinitely repeating unit cell is broken.

Apr 22, 2019 the defects in the crystal are arises when crystallization takes place at the fast or moderate rates because the constituent particles does not get sufficient time to arrange in perfect order. Software testing is an investigation conducted to provide stakeholders with information about the quality of the software product or service under test. They are common because positions of atoms or molecules at repeating fixed distances determined by the unit cell parameters in crystals, which exhibit a periodic crystal structure, are usually imperfect. Validating software for manufacturing processes by david a. For example, we track test code defects, product code defects, documentation issues, etc in our databases. Software development lifecycle sdlc defect and test case measurement january 2006 pragmatic software newsletters measuring the software development lifecycle employing a solid software development lifecycle sdlc methodology can drastically increase your ability. How do you decide which defects are acceptable for the software. All solids, even the most perfect crystals contain defects. The compounds in which the number of cation and anions are exactly in the same ratio as represented by their chemical formula are called stoichiometric compounds. For absolute beginners, i offer my help on skype absolutely free, if requested.

If you find any query regarding this post feel free to ask. These common software problems appear in a wide variety of applications and environments, but are especially prone to be seen in dirty systems. The waste reduction will improve the efficiency and productivity of a work, assuming the waste is resistance or dispute in. Dennis martinez shares three universal dos and donts of test automation that are well worth keeping in mind. Potential of nearinfrared spectroscopy to detect defects on the surface of solid wood boards. The course material is succinct, yet comprehensive. Learn how to develop maintainable software systems applying design patterns based on meta and solid principles. Depending on the complexity of the product, rework of software or hardware may be needed to correct the issue. Pdf firstprinciples calculations for point defects in solids. In the same year hamill and gosevapopstojanova showed that requirements defects are among the most common types of defects in software development and that the major sources of failures are defects in requirements 32.

Surface engineering of catalysts allows the tailoring of active sites. The primary purpose behind testing is to trace out the maximum defects, present in a software product, a tester needs to be aware about the different types of the defects, which may prevail in a software product. The main groups are point defects, extended defects and dislocations. Teaching approach no fluff, no ranting, no beating the air. There are two different types of substitutional defects. After over 30 years of combined software defect analysis performed by ourselves and colleagues, we have identified 20 common software problems. A good testing program encompasses a diverse collection of test protocols. Imperfections in solids and defects in crystals study. A nightmare of any qa engineer is a bug which returns from production. What is casting defects types, causes and remedies. In software development, waste can also be produced, as discussed by 7. Software bug, a failure of computer software to meet requirements. Logic errors compilation errors i would say this is the most uncommon one. This helps for faster reaction and most importantly, appropriate reaction.

Defects or imperfections in crystalline solid can be divided into four groups namely line defects, point defects, volume defects and surface defects. For a better understanding of the defect detection issue, lets explore several most common types. So, to differentiate between bug types categorize by issue type. Whar are the different types of defectserrors are commonly. Types of solid solutions the name substitutionalof this solid solution tells you exactly what happens as atoms of the parent metal are replaced or substituted by atoms of the alloying metal. Feb 18, 2020 the primary purpose behind testing is to trace out the maximum defects, present in a software product, a tester needs to be aware about the different types of the defects, which may prevail in a software product. A general range of extrinsic defects are known as colour defects. Solidcasts user friendly software simulates multiple casting types with rich features, accounting for variables in sand, investment, and permanent mold castings. The evolvability defect classification is based on the defect types found in this study. Three types of tests to automate and three types to skip. There exist three main groups with additional subgroups. Starting with solid principles we will go further to the metaprinciples. We classify and quatify point defects like selfinterstitialatoms and w atom next. That defects are a source of software development waste should be selfevident, but exactly how do we measure the amount of waste created by a single defect.

Following are the methods for preventing programmers from introducing bugs during development. These defects normally exist in following situation. This tutorialcourse has been retrieved from udemy which you can download for absolutely free. Measuring and managing inprocess software quality stephen h.

There is an unmet need for new techniques and methods of healing critical size tissue defects, by further reduction of invasiveness in implant, cell. These types of substitutional defects are often referred to as offcenter ions. The thermodynamical potential for dilute solutions is rederived, generalized and applied to defects in solids. Here the authors produce a heterogeneous nanoceria catalyst with engineered. If validation efforts only include testing, engineers are probably overlooking critical validation activities. A successful mathematical classification method for physical lattice defects, which works not only with the theory of dislocations and other defects in crystals but also, e.

The 20 most common software problems general testing. Type of point defects point defects in a crystal may be classified into three types. Casting is the process of producing a determined shape by melting solid metal into liquid form, pouring it into a mold cavity and letting it solidify into the desired shape. Sometimes functional defects are classified as change requests as they were not a part of the originally given requirements. A defect is a physical, functional, or aesthetic attribute of a product or service that exhibits that the product or service failed to meet one of the desired specifications. How can i find the crystal defects of a single crystal. Solidsolid interface an overview sciencedirect topics. How can you interpret a testphase defect curve correctly to reflect the true quality status. Complex software is not defect free and it is a chicken and egg story on closing defects visavis working software.

Solidworks ecad ecad design software for solidworks. It should be noted that the interface energy can vary from a very small number for coherent type interfaces up to about the surface energy for highangle grain boundaries. The cost of fixing defects is dependent on resources need to fix a defect. This defect is due to nonstoichiometric ratio in the crystal structure.

Design gates, risers and test them out before making your first casting. There are several types of point defects and substitutional defect is one of them. It can also be error, flaw, failure, or fault in a computer program. High severity and priority defects are usually the ones that would impact the day to day usage of the software. One more angle to see a defect in a software application is on the basis of its probability to occur and getting encountered by the user.

A document describing the scope, approach, resources and schedule of intended test activities. Instead, these defects improved software evolvability by making it easier to. It utilizes a parametric featurebased technique to create assemblies. Here we have discussed about what is casting defects types, causes and remedies to eliminate it. Whar are the different types of defectserrors are commonly appear during the real time software te answer srikanth bc when the tester identifies a defect, he assigns a severity to it. The positions of atoms or molecules occur on repeating fixed distances, determined by the unit cell parameters. The middle english word bugge is the basis for the terms bugbear and bugaboo as terms used for a monster the term bug to describe defects has been a part of engineering jargon since the 1870s and predates electronic computers and computer software. Roboticassisted 3d bioprinting for repairing bone and. Causes of software defects and cost of fixing defects. The defects of timber are occurred due to natural forces, attack by insects, fungi, defective seasoning, defective conversion.

Crystalline imperfections or defects are always present. A point defect occurs when one or more atoms of a crystalline solid leave their original lattice site andor foreign atoms occupy the interstitial position lattice site of the crystal. But sometimes, it is important to understand the nature, its implications and the cause to process it better. A software bug arises when the expected result dont match with the actual results. Abstract using inprocess metrics to determine the quality status of a software project under development is easier said than done. Solid state welding ssw types of solid state welding process solid state welding is a welding process, in which two work pieces are joined under a pressure providing an intimate contact between them and at a temperature essentially below the melting point of the parent material. Reinforces theoretical concepts by placing emphasis on real world processes and applications. Crystallographic defects are interruptions of regular patterns in crystalline solids. Provides a thorough understanding of the chemistry and physics of defects, enabling the reader to manipulate them in the engineering of materials.

A test plan is a document describing software testing scope and activities. Substitutional defect occurs when the original atom in the lattice site of a crystalline solid is replaced by a different type of atom. Jun cao, a hao liang, a xue lin, b wenjun tu, a and yizhuo zhang a, defects on the surface of solid wood boards directly affect their mechanical properties and product grades. This course teaches the fundamentals of composite manufacturing, including fiber and resinbased processes, and shows ways to detect and repair defects. How do you decide on the extent of defects and the type of defects that you can. Going through the solid principles, youll also learn about the related patterns. The solidworks plastics course teaches you how to use specialized simulation software tools to predict how melted plastic flows during the injection molding process. Product defects are the defects that are introduced and detected during the various stages of software development life cycle.

Software development lifecycle sdlc defect and test. Main types of defects in software testing process deviqa. Sometimes it is also known as intrinsic or thermodynamic defects. There are two types of point defect in solid solutions. Crystal defect crystalline solids exhibits a periodic crystal structure. The foreign atom may be of same size or different either larger or smaller. This category of defects include the fcenter and the hcenter defects. An ebook reader can be a software application for use on a computer such as microsofts free reader application, or a booksized computer that is used solely as a reading device such as nuvomedias rocket ebook. Software support inside and outside solidstate devices. Defects are of great importance as they can affect properties such as mechanical strength, electrical conductivity, chemical reactivity and corrosion. Most bugs arise from mistakes and errors made by developers, architects. On the classification and quantification of crystal defects after.

Learn how to apply meta and solid principles to make your application robust. Solid frustratedlewispair catalysts constructed by. Unlike interstitial defect, foreign atom should occupy the lattice site only and not the interstitial position, as depicted below. Substances in the solid state, or solids, are distinguished by stability of shape and by the nature of the thermal motion of their atoms, which perform small oscillations about equilibrium positions. Defects can have a large effect on a range of properties of the material, such as the mechanical strength, electrical conductivity, corrosion and chemical reactivity. Point defects stoichiometric defect, frenkel defect. Predicting how the plastic will flow enables you to predict manufacturing defects such as weld lines, air traps, short shots, and sink marks. Get to understand the essentials of srp, ocp, lsp, isp and dip, which combine to be called by the acronym solid. Paracord grab bag includes one 1 or more, depending on quantity ordered, 100 ft.

Substitutional defect point defect defects in solid. To find and fix defects is cheap and efficient in early stages of development. Learn how to develop maintainable software systems applying meta and solid principles. Ppt defects in solids powerpoint presentation free to. It is the basis for formally testing any softwareproduct in a project. From a thermodynamic point of view a solid containing point defects constitutes a solid. Software support inside and outside solidstate devices for. These types of defects are the ones that must be fixed before we golive. Historically, crystal point defects were first regarded in ionic crystals, not in metal crystals that were much simpler. The cost of defects rises considerably across the software life cycle. Other categories we often use for triage include blocking branch, feature path, milestone or sprint, triage, and status active, in work, resolved, closed. In this kind of point defect, the ratio of positive and negative ions stoichiometric and electrical neutrality of a solid is not disturbed.

I would say there are three types of software bugs. Software testing can also provide an objective, independent view of the software to allow the business to appreciate. How much does solidworks license cost solidworks is a solid modeling computeraided design or cad and computeraided engineering or cae in one program that runs on microsoft windows. The number and type of defects depend on several factors e. Software testing can also provide an objective, independent view of the software to allow the business to appreciate and understand the risks of software implementation. Hawk ridge systems is 100% focused on your success with solidworks. We support all types of design, engineering and manufacturing teams throughout the us and canada and we are committed to helping you get the most out of your 3d design software products. Bug tracking tools are extremely valuable software for any company, and there are a number of choices out there. The more you fix defects there is more likelihood that a new defect has been injected while closing the defect. In interstitial solid solutions the atoms of the parent or solvent metal are bigger than the atoms of the alloying or solute metal.

Pv module defects are well studied and classified according to their nature, origin, and influence on the panel performance. Choosing the best software testing tools for your business. The properties of the materials are affected by defects e. It identifies amongst others test items, the features to be tested, the testing tasks. These types of defects, have no impact on the working of a product, and sometimes, it is ignored and skipped, such as spelling or grammatical mistake. The automated functional testing tools presented here range from simple, standalone tools to parts of a larger testing suite. Using moldflow software like solidworks plastics will help you identify ideal gate locations, anticipate air pockets, flow or weld lines, and vacuum voids. Defects are primarly classified into product defects and process defects. Potential of nearinfrared spectroscopy to detect defects. This post is on types of software errors that every testers should know. Analysis of shrinkage defect using solidcast software and.

695 373 1559 1656 838 554 812 511 40 998 593 206 1410 587 1595 1603 675 805 862 475 108 1199 332 277 1067 875 875